MP involved in nasty accident, condition critical

Buyaga East Member of Parliament, Eric Musana is admitted at Nakasero hospital in critical condition following a nasty accident along Mityana- Kampala highway, Tuesday.

The accident happened at around 9:00am at Busimbi town when Musana’s car, a Prado TX, registration number UBB, 144R collided head on with a canter truck, registration number UBA, 530s which was plying the opposite route.

According to Wamala Regional Police spokesperson Norbert Ochom, the legislator was over speeding when in effort to circumvent a boda boda, instead slammed into the truck.

“He was over speeding and he tried to dodge a boda boda man and rammed into a truck. This was recklessness on the side of the MP,” Ochom said.

Musana was shortly admitted at Mityana hospital but his condition worsened prompting his referral to Nakasero where reports indicate he is fighting for life.
